The entire network liquidation in the past 24 hours rose to US$491 million
According to Coinglass data on November 10th, the total network liquidation in the past 24 hours has risen to 491 million US dollars, including long positions liquidation of 219 million US dollars and short positions liquidation of 273 million US dollars. In addition, with the severe market fluctuations, the total network liquidation in the past hour reached 8.2222 million US dollars, including long positions liquidation of 640,100 US dollars and short positions liquidation of 7.5821 million US dollars.
